This role is for one of the foremost integrated marketing, communications and PR agencies in the field of healthcare and technology. Their clients include successful IT vendors, digital health companies and public and private healthcare providers. Their culture reflects their relentless pursuit of excellence for their clients, the highest professional integrity and a collaborative approach to relationships.

Steady growth has created an opportunity for an experienced marketing executive, specialising in PR and digital engagement, to bring digital marketing ideas, experience and execution to the brand offering.

Key Responsibilities
Working closely with account teams and the content team, you will:
- Develop and execute online marketing strategies to improve traffic rates, lead generation and conversions
- Formulate and deliver marketing plans, ideas and solutions to key clients, primarily maximising social media, identifying key channels, adapting content, utilising digital tools for best measurement and building and monitoring activity plans
- Develop skills across PR campaigns including liaison with media and monitoring for coverage
- Carry out research and social listening across all client markets
- Apply traditional marketing and communication strategies to online audiences
- Write articles, blogs and stories for PR placement and other promotional material
- Support the day to day running of the business

The Candidate
- You will be a graduate with at least 2 years’ experience in an agency or a consultancy and possibly in account management.
- Some cross-discipline experience in media relations, PR and graphic design would be an advantage.
- Passion, energy and drive are a must.

You will be able to:
- Assess and comprehend client needs and design and implement timely, creative and appropriate solutions
- Apply traditional marketing tools in a digital world, adding value to largely B2B clients’ business plans
- Work with digital / social insights and tools from Google Analytics, content management platforms to social platform insights and social listening tools
- Apply digital and social measurement from KPI development to tracking and campaign evaluation
- Deploy paid social media campaigns
- Apply SEO and utilise content in the digital and social space
- Analyse and report on visitor data
- Devise new ways to market products and services
- Write skill-fully and creatively across a range of communications including internal newsletters, reports and press-releases (pre-written copy and proposals)
- Engage confidently in media, new media and technologies in placing content
- Self-motivate and multi-task across several projects
